Additional Information of Eligibility:In accordance with the Marine Debris Act, eligible applicants are state, local, tribal, and territory governments, institutions of higher education, nonprofit organizations, or commercial (for-profit) organizations with expertise in a field related to marine debris.
Applications from federal agencies or employees of federal agencies will not be considered.
Interested federal agencies may collaborate with eligible applicants but may not receive funds through this competition.
All projects must take place within the United States or territories or their respective waterways.
Foreign organizations and foreign public entities (non-U. S. or territory organizations) are not eligible to apply as the primary applicant but can be listed as a sub-awardee or contractor.
NOAA is strongly committed to broadening the participation of veterans, minority-serving institutions, and entities that work in underserved areas.
The NOAA MDP encourages proposals from, or involving any of the above types of institutions.
Applications that have been submitted to other NOAA grant programs or as part of another NOAA grant may be considered under this solicitation.
